2020 thoughts:
Beautiful. Two women on opposite sides of a temporal conflict exchange letters - with the correspondence beginning as a sort of taunt but quickly developing into something else entirely. I didn't expect to love this as much as I did but wow. The character development in this novella is incredible, especially for such a short text, and just enough of the world + the conflict is revealed to the reader.
